Square Enix introduced that “In HarvestellaIn the game, players will start a new life in a beautiful world that changes with the flow of the seasons and experience many exciting activities such as tending crops, making friends with townspeople and conquering dungeons. challenging evening.”

Former Final Fantasy XII artist, Mr. Kamikokuryo Isamu is the concept art for Harvestella, and the game’s music is composed by Shiina Go, the famous composer of the Tales game series.

Harvestalla is set in a vibrant and colorful world where four giant crystals known as the Seaslight create a steady change between the four seasons. The adventure begins when anomalies begin to appear in Seaslight, creating Quietus – the season of death that intertwines the natural transformation of the four seasons.

“During the Quietus period, trees and crops dried up and people couldn’t go on adventures outside of town. More worrisome is that this kind of deadly season mysteriously extends year after year.”

Players can choose the job that best suits them from a list of careers such as Fighter, Shadow Walker or Mage, and traverse dungeons with teammates to uncover the world’s origins and the truth behind the tragedy. Quietus painting.

Fans can now pre-order Harvestella digitally on Steam and Nintendo Switch. The game will also be released as a card for Nintendo’s consoles.
